For the 2025 school year, there are 2 private schools serving 600 students in the neighborhood of Edison Park, Chicago, IL.
The top ranked private school in Edison Park is St. Juliana School.
50% of private schools in Edison Park are religiously affiliated (most commonly Catholic).
